I made videos with my camera (Fujifilm).
I transferred these videos to the computer.
I transferred these videos (in .AVI format) to a USB stick.
I plugged this USB stick (which also contains 2 movies in .avi) into my TV to watch them.
The movies play fine, but the files from the camera do not play. A message on the screen indicates: "unsupported file".

    It is probably a codec problem.

    Compare the codecs of your playable files with those that are unplayable and convert the latter with the same codecs as the former. To do this, you can use MediaInfo (portable version preferred) for example.
